Posana is Asheville’s Only 100% Gluten-Free Restaurant. And in 2025 they opened a second location!  If you or someone in your group is not gluten-free, don’t let that stop you from dining at Posana, this fine dining spot is an experience any foodie will enjoy.

Environment

As of writing, I have only visited the downtown location. Posana is an upscale restaurant in downtown Asheville with indoor, outdoor, and bar seating, plus a dedicated event space for private gatherings. While there’s no official dress code, the leather-backed chairs and finely rolled silverware give the space an elegant feel. And I personally love an excuse to dress up, so sign me up!

Food

Due to the higher price tag, Posana is more of a special occasion spot for me. That said, I absolutely believe the prices reflect the quality of the ingredients and experience. My first visit was when my family came to town, thanks for dinner, Dad! I have also had the chance to dine there a few more times since then. Once being after Hurricane Helene when they offered a more budget-friendly lunch menu and when they offered an Easter Brunch.

Posana serves dinner Wednesday through Sunday, and while reservations aren’t required, they are recommended. Their seasonal menus highlight locally sourced ingredients, making every visit feel unique.

Since everything on the menu is gluten-free, this Celiac girlie was both thrilled and a little overwhelmed. Thankfully, my dad and stepmom were happy to share, so we ordered a mix of appetizers, entrées, and dessert. While I can’t remember every dish we tried, I do recall one staple, Posana’s famous cheddar biscuits, which came highly recommended by a friend. We also had a pork dish that was delicious, though the details are a bit fuzzy now.

During my post-Hurricane Helene visit, Posana ran a $5 hamburger special, an absolute steal. My friend Sam from Unmasked Nutrition joined me, and we treated ourselves to burgers and drinks. Naturally, I upgraded to the parmesan truffle fries because, well, truffles. Ever since trying them in Italy, I’ve been obsessed, and finding gluten-free truffle fries in a dedicated fryer is rare. Let’s just say I did a happy Celiac girl dance while eating my meal.

On my most recent visit to Posana, I had the chance to enjoy their special Easter Brunch, a rare treat since they typically only serve dinner. As always, the entire menu was completely gluten-free, which makes dining there such a relaxing experience. I ordered the biscuits and gravy which came with a side of fried potatoes, and it was every bit as comforting as it sounds. The biscuits were tender and buttery, the gravy rich and flavorful, and together they created that classic Southern comfort food experience I hadn’t had in years. It felt nostalgic, a simple dish done so well, and one that’s nearly impossible to find gluten-free anywhere else.

Final Thoughts

Posana is a fantastic choice for any diner, gluten-free or not, looking for an elevated dining experience in downtown Asheville or Biltmore Park. Since their menu rotates seasonally, I can’t offer specific recommendations, but I have no doubt you’ll find something to love.
